Updated 8-12-08 These are not really good pictures, it is pretty hard to see the small holes I suggest you hold your filter up to the light after it is washed and dried, Take your time and look at it for 30 seconds or so. I like to stop dirt particles measured in microns not thousands of a inch. Even after oiling the filter with K&N oil you still see open holes, no matter how much oil is sprayed on the filter I still see open holes in the filter media.
